Find the value of `x` for which `f(x)=sqrt(sinx-cosx)` is defined, `x in [0,2pi)dot`

Text Solution

Verified by Experts

`f(x)=sqrt(sinx-cosx) " is defined if " sinxgecosx`.

From the graph, `sinxge cosx,for x in [pi/4,(5pi)/4]`.
